Regarding the questions---
1-It is absolutely NORMAL to have a high normal or moderately elevated T4 when on T4 replacement, and with TSH in the normal range. With T4 levels in the normal rang e on T4 replacement, T3 levels tend to be too low.
2-That is not a combination of tests Iwould expect, except in thyroid hormone resistance syndrome, a congenital disease not present here. The TSH is the best guide for treatment in almost every instance.

An allergen-specific immunoglobulin E (IgE) test measures the levels of different IgE antibodies. IgE antibodies are normally found in small amounts in the blood, but higher amounts can be found when the body overreacts to allergens.

Cold compresses can help reduce swelling in the area. Cooling also helps to numb sharp pain. Apply an ice pack for up to 20 minutes, up to five times a day. Use a frozen gel pack, ice cubes in a plastic bag, or a bag of frozen peas. Wrap the cold pack in a soft towel. Do not apply a cold pack directly to skin.
Heat therapy
heat helps to relax tense muscles and soothe a stiff area. It can help with muscle pain and bonny pain. Use a heated gel pack, heating pad or a hot water bottle.
